Accellos and HighJump Software Merge

The product portfolio helps manage complex order fulfillment cycles and collaborate with supply chain partners

Colorado Springs, Colo. and Minneapolis, Minn.July 16, 2014Accellos and HighJump Software, each global providers of supply chain management software and trading partner network technology, announced that they agreed to merge, creating a market leader with 11,000 customers in 23 countries with operations in North America, Asia and Europe. The combination of the two companies creates a product portfolio that is positioned to meet the advancing needs of retailers, distributors, manufacturers, and logistics service providers to manage complex order fulfillment cycles and collaborate with supply chain partners.

The combination of Accellos and HighJump brings together a unique set of technologies, including networked trading partner connectivity, warehouse management, transportation management and route delivery. This creates the opportunity for customers to work with a single technology provider with an adaptable technology backbone for omni-channel supply chain operations and organizations of all sizes.

The merged company operates under the name HighJump and continues to use the Accellos brand for midmarket supply chain execution technology. Accellos founder and CEO Michael Cornell was appointed CEO.
